How Life Works Here
Wicketts End is located in Canterbury, near Whitstable, Kent. Crime rates are above average, with 206 incidents recorded in 12 months. Violence and sexual offences are the most frequent category. Violent offences make up 46% of reports.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Cranleigh Gardens) is 206m away. The median property price is £201,500, with exceptional growth of 55% over five years. Based on 36 transactions recorded since 2014. The market is highly active with frequent sales. Rented accommodation predominates. There are 6 schools within 2 km, 6 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 204m away. Note that above-average crime in the area may offset the school accessibility for families. The area sits within Flood Zone 2 (river and sea flooding), indicating medium flood risk. It is worth checking the Environment Agency flood map for current details. This street may particularly suit property investors. Market indicators suggest an upward trend. Overall, this street scores 47 out of 100 for liveability.
